数据库合并是指将两个或多个数据库中的数据合并为一个统一的数据库。在合并过程中,需要考虑数据冲突、数据一致性、数据完整性等问题。
数据库合并的分类:
- 垂直合并:将不同数据库中的不同表按照某种规则合并到一个数据库中,适用于数据结构相似但来源不同的情况。
- 水平合并:将不同数据库中的相同表按照某种规则合并到一个数据库中,适用于数据结构相同但来源不同的情况。
- 混合合并:同时进行垂直合并和水平合并,适用于数据结构既相似又相同但来源不同的情况。
数据库合并的优势:
- 数据集中管理:合并后的数据库可以集中管理数据,减少数据冗余和重复存储,提高数据利用率。
- 数据一致性:通过合并,可以保证数据在不同数据库之间的一致性,避免数据冲突和不一致的问题。
- 数据共享与协作:合并后的数据库可以方便地实现数据共享和协作,提高团队协作效率。
- 系统性能优化:合并后的数据库可以通过优化数据库结构和索引等方式提高系统性能和查询效率。
数据库合并的应用场景:
- 公司合并:当两个或多个公司合并时,需要将各自的数据库合并为一个统一的数据库,以实现数据共享和一致性。
- 数据库迁移:当需要将数据从一个数据库迁移到另一个数据库时,可以通过合并的方式将两个数据库的数据合并到目标数据库中。
- 数据整合与分析:在数据分析和挖掘领域,需要将多个数据源的数据整合到一个数据库中,以便进行综合分析和挖掘。
腾讯云相关产品和产品介绍链接地址:
- 云数据库 TencentDB:提供高可用、可扩展的云数据库服务,支持主从复制、备份恢复、自动扩容等功能。详情请参考:https://cloud.tencent.com/product/cdb
- 云数据库 Redis:提供高性能、高可靠性的云端 Redis 服务,支持数据持久化、备份恢复、集群部署等功能。详情请参考:https://cloud.tencent.com/product/redis
- 云数据库 MongoDB:提供高性能、可扩展的云端 MongoDB 服务,支持自动备份、数据恢复、集群部署等功能。详情请参考:https://cloud.tencent.com/product/cosmosdb
请注意,以上仅为腾讯云的相关产品示例,其他云计算品牌商也提供类似的数据库合并解决方案。